> Since the test2-mm1 sources I get the following error during boot:
>
> VP_IDE: IDE controller at PCI slot 0000:00:11.1
> VP_IDE: (ide_setup_pci_device:) Could not enable device.
>
> This results in not being able to use DMA for any devices connected to
> my IDE controller. Hdparm says permission denied when I do a hdparm -d1
> /dev/hda e.g.
>
> I checked with a vanilla kernel and everything is working fine there.
> Going through the broken-out patches from Andrew Morton I found the one
> patch that caused the above behavior: nforce2-acpi-fixes.patch

Thanks for working that out. It must have taken some time.

> I do not know why it should interfere with my via stuff, but it does. A
> vanilla test3 kernel is working fine as well, whereas test3-mm1 shows
> the same error as before with test2-mmX.

Me either. Unfortunately that patch does five different things so we
cannot easily narrow it down further.
